New Delhi:  Bihar and Uttar Pradesh have received heavy rainfall in the last few days. Heavy rain alert has been issued in many districts of these two states on 30 September as well.

If we talk about the national capital Delhi, IMD has given bad news to the people of Delhi who are waiting for rain . If the weather department is to be believed, the heat is going to increase once again in Delhi. The sky is expected to remain clear till October 5. Monsoon will also depart in the next few days.

According to the Meteorological Department, the sky may be partly cloudy on Monday but there is no possibility of rain. The maximum temperature may be 35 degrees Celsius and the minimum temperature may be 25 degrees Celsius.

There is heavy rain in these states including UP-Bihar

According to the Meteorological Department, monsoon has once again become active in UP-Bihar, Rajasthan, Jharkhand. Rain is expected in these states on Monday. For Bihar's capital Patna, the Meteorological Department has issued an alert of rain, thunder and wind speed of 30 to 40 kilometers for September 30.

Talking about hilly states, there is a possibility of light to moderate rain in many areas of Himachal Pradesh and Jammu today.
